This lot comprises approximately two dozen vintage vinyl records in their printed cardboard sleeves, alongside a few pieces of sheet music. The collection spans popular music from the mid-to-late 20th century, featuring visible titles and artists such as "Motown Chartbusters Vol. 3," "Nat King Cole Greatest Love Songs," "Reflections From Tennessee," "Melody," "Engelbert Humperdinck," "Neil Sedaka's," "Johnny Nash's," "The Geoff Love Singers," "20 Flop Greats," "FANTASY ORIGINS," and "Birthday Songs." Among the records identified are "Paul Renard Organ With Percussion" and "The Happy Organ, Plays The Unforgettables." Record labels including RCA and K-Tel are also visible. The lot also includes "Organ" sheet music from a "Manhattan production." The items are constructed of vinyl discs housed in cardboard jackets and paper for the sheet music.
